Pediatric OTs and OTAs frequently work with children with specific learning impairments, such as dysgraphia and disorders of written expression that impact handwriting. Kelli Fetter, MS, OTR/L has experience in these areas as both an occupational therapist and a mother.  Kelli shares her lived experiences in this course to prepare OT practitioners to better address these areas by providing the tools, resources and research to implement effective intervention strategies based on the current evidence and best practices.

Kelli L. Fetter, M.S., OTR/L
Aspire OT Instructor

Kelli Fetter is an Occupational Therapist and Certified Handwriting Specialist. She formerly practiced OT for 10+ years and has extensive experience in pediatrics and more recently learning differences, including dysgraphia. She is trained in Handwriting Without Tears curriculum, Size Matters Program, and Because Neatness Matters Handwriting Programs and has specialized knowledge with Dysgraphia, Dyslexia, ADHD, Autism, Developmental Disabilities, and more. She also has personal experience as a parent of a child with dyslexia and dysgraphia, which has led to her passion in helping children who are struggling with academics. Kelli has experience as an adjunct professor teaching pediatric and kinesiology courses in an occupational therapy assistant program. Kelli is the owner of Handwriting Solutions, which is a resource for families who need handwriting support.
